Quell the Snore: Effective Snoring Aids

Are you or here your partner suffering from the nightly symphony of snores? Snoring can impair sleep for both partners, leading to tension. Luckily, there are many effective snoring aids available to help you overcome this common problem.

  • Anti-Snore Nasal Dilators work by widening the nasal passages, allowing for more efficient airflow and stopping snoring.
  • Chin Straps gently secure the chin, keeping the airway clear. This can be particularly helpful for those who snore due to relaxed jaw muscles
  • Custom Mouthguards are designed by dentists to adjust the jaw and tongue, preventing the airway from collapsing.

In addition to these aids, alterations like avoiding alcohol before bed can also improve snoring. Talk to your doctor if snoring is severe or accompanied by other symptoms, as it could indicate a health concern.

Rest Easy: Finding the Perfect Earplugs for You

Finding the perfect earplugs can be a game-changer for your sleep. Whether you're battling noisy neighbors, struggling with traffic sounds, or simply seeking tranquility, the right earplugs can muffle those bothersome noises and help you fall asleep.

But with so many types available, how do you find the perfect pair for you?

Consider your sleeping position. Side sleepers might prefer smaller, more comfortable earplugs, while back sleepers could benefit from larger, sturdy options. Think about the level of noise dampening you need.

If you're in a particularly noisy environment, consider earplugs with a higher Noise Reduction Rating (NRR). Finally, don't forget to experiment different materials and shapes until you find what feels most comfortable for your ears.

Say Goodbye to Sleep Disruptions: A Guide to Snoring Relief

Worn out of sleepless nights caused by snoring? You're not solitary. Snoring can be a frustrating issue for both the person who snores and their bedmate. Luckily, there are steps you can take to find solace.

First, it's important to know the origins of snoring. Many factors can contribute to this common problem, including your sleeping posture, allergies, and being overweight.

Once you have a better grasp of what's causing your snoring, you can start to put into action some simple remedies.

Here are a few tips that may help:

  • Experiment with sleeping on your side instead of your back.
  • Adjust your bed to incline your head slightly upwards.
  • Maintain a healthy weight.
  • Limit your intake of alcohol and sedatives in the hours leading up to sleep.
  • If snoring persists, consult with a doctor.
